Stolen Goods May Belong To You, Troopers Suspect

CHECK YOUR STORAGE UNITS Stolen Goods May Belong To You, Troopers Suspect ONEONTA – If you live in the Oneonta area check your storage units, sheds or garages, state police are suggesting. If you find items missing, you may be able to reclaim them 1-3 p.m. Wednesday at the Oneonta Barracks, 199 Oneida St. In August 2020, a number of items troopers believe were taken from storage units, shed or vehicles over the summer were recovered during arrests at a…

Pathfinder Village Names Hand Bell Choir Director

Pathfinder Village Names Hand Bell Choir Director Paula Schaeffer Retires After 23 Years EDMESTON – Maisy French of West Edmeston has been appointed director of the Pathfinder Village Hand Bell Choir, and is planning a virtual concert later this year, it was announced this morning. She succeeds Paula Schaeffer of Fly Creek, Pathfinder director of Enrichment Services, who has retired after 23 years in the role.…

NYT Finds Otsego County At ‘Extremely High Risk’

CLICK HERE FOR FULL REPORT NYT Finds Otsego County At ‘Extremely High Risk’ The New York Times is reporting Otsego County at an “extremely high risk level” for COVID-19. “Cases are extremely high and have increased over the past two weeks,” said The Times in its county-by-county assessment.  “The number of hospitalized Covid patients has fallen in the Otsego County area. Deaths have remained at about the same level. The test positivity rate in Otsego County is high, suggesting that cases may be undercounted.”…

Bassett Vaccination Clinic For 300 Fills ‘Immediately’

Bassett Vaccination Clinic For 300 Fills ‘Immediately’ COOPERSTOWN – As anticipated, Bassett’s Saturday COVID vaccination clinic filled “immediately,” according to spokesman Karen Huxtable-Hooker. As soon at the posting appeared on bassett.org, all appointments were booked. “Hopefully we see additional supply of the COVID-19 vaccines coming to New York State and released to rural regions soon,” she said.…

Village Board Approves Girl Scouts’ Inclusive Vision

Cherry Valley Board OKs Girl Scouts’ Inclusive Vision By CHRYSTAL SAVAGE • Special to www.AllOTSEGO.com CHERRY VALLEY – Girl Scouts, Bailey Thayer and Zola Palmer are making a difference in their community. When brainstorming service project ideas, the fourth and fifth-grade juniors suggested improving the village playground behind the Cherry Valley Community Center – formerly the Cherry Valley School – by adding more equipment. Specifically, Zola is excited to add spinners to the current equipment. “I like to spin,” she…
